How to verify your account before requesting a withdrawal
Account verification is a mandatory step before any withdrawal can be processed at Jogou Ganhou Casino. This process, known as Know Your Customer (KYC), is designed to prevent fraud and money laundering. You will need to provide clear copies of identification documents, such as a passport or driving licence, along with proof of address like a utility bill or bank statement.
The verification can be completed before you even make a deposit, which is highly recommended. Once you upload the documents through the secure portal, the verification team typically reviews them within 24 to 48 hours. If any documents are unclear or expired, you will be asked to resubmit, which can delay your first withdrawal. Keeping your documents ready and updated ensures a smooth experience.
- A valid government-issued photo ID (passport, driver’s licence, or national ID card)
- A recent utility bill or bank statement showing your name and address (dated within the last three months)
- Proof of payment method ownership, such as a screenshot of an e-wallet or a photo of your card
- Additional documents may be requested for high-value withdrawals

Cryptocurrency withdrawal methods and benefits
Cryptocurrency withdrawals have become a cornerstone of modern online gambling, and Jogou Ganhou Casino fully embraces this trend. Players can withdraw in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and other major altcoins. The primary benefit is speed: blockchain transactions are processed almost instantly, though network congestion can cause minor delays. Another advantage is the enhanced privacy, as crypto transactions do not require personal banking details.
The casino provides a unique wallet address for each cryptocurrency. You must copy this address carefully and paste it into your crypto wallet when initiating the withdrawal. Due to the irreversible nature of blockchain transactions, double-checking the address is critical. Once the casino releases the funds, they are sent directly to your wallet, often within an hour.

Best practices for account security
To enhance your own security, never share your account password or 2FA codes with anyone. Use a strong, unique password for your casino account and change it periodically. Avoid using public Wi-Fi when initiating withdrawals, as these networks are more vulnerable to interception. By taking these precautions, you minimise the risk of your account being compromised.
If you suspect any unauthorised activity, contact customer support immediately. The casino can freeze your account temporarily while an investigation is conducted. Keeping your contact details up to date ensures that you receive alerts about any account changes or withdrawal requests.
